The Microsoft Visual Basic for Applications Core is a set of libraries and tools that provide a foundation for building VBA applications. It includes a range of features, such as:
A cloud-based service that allows you to create automated workflows between apps and services without writing any code at all.
For most users, VBA is already installed with Microsoft Office. If it appears to be missing or unresponsive, you can enable it through these steps: MicroStation Forum - Visual Basic for Applications Core download microsoft visual basic for applications core
Run the installer to embed the VBA Core engine into that specific application. System Requirements for VBA Core
Ultimate Guide to Download Microsoft Visual Basic for Applications Core The Microsoft Visual Basic for Applications Core is
| Feature | 32-bit VBA | 64-bit VBA | | :--- | :--- | :--- | | | 32-bit Office (older versions) | 64-bit Office (Office 2019, 2021, 365) | | Data Handling | Uses 32-bit pointers; data is limited to 2GB. | Uses 64-bit pointers ( LongLong type); can access more physical memory. | | API Declarations | Uses standard Declare statements. | Requires the PtrSafe keyword and LongLong for pointers. | | Conditional Compilation | Can use Win64 constant, but it will only be True when the Office host is 64-bit, not the OS. | Primarily uses #If VBA7 Then to check for VBA version compatibility. |
If you click the Visual Basic button and receive an error stating that the component is missing or not installed, your Office installation may be incomplete. You can download and restore the VBA Core through the Windows settings. Close all Microsoft Office applications. Open the Windows menu (Press Win + I ). Navigate to Apps > Installed apps (or Apps & features ). If it appears to be missing or unresponsive,
In Excel or Word, go to File > Options > Customize Ribbon and check the Developer box.